Cl. 182230 3 Claims ABSTRACT OF THE DISCLOSURE A kneeling device for use by cement finishers and others comprising a smooth flat base having upwardly and inwardly curved end portions which constitute handles extending across the entire width of the base, and a kneeling pad on the base spaced from the ends of the base to provide spaces which make the inner surfaces of the handles accessible for engagement by the fingers of the user or a tool for lifting or moving the device. The pad is made of non-absorbent, non-porous, resilient material which is instantly expansible when pressure applied thereto has been released and which yieldingly and comfortably supports the knees of the user without bottoming.
This invention relates to a kneeling device of the kind used by workmen for kneeling upon in proximity to their work. Such devices called kneeling boards are commonly used by cement finishers.
The object of this invention is to provide a kneeling device which can be moved easily from one place tov another, which is slidable over a supporting surface, impervious to moisture, and provides comfortable support for the knees of the user.
Another object is to construct the kneeling area of material which is resilient, non-porous and non-absorbtive, which expands and rebounds instantly after pressure applied thereto has been released. Although the kneeling pad may be relatively thin, the chosen material is such that the knees of the user are suported without bottoming, that is, in spaced relationship to the base of the device.
The base of the kneeling device preferably is made of smooth plastic material which is moldable to provide handle means at opposite ends, continuous across the entire ends of the device and spaced from the kneeling pad area sufificiently to give easy access to the handles for grasping by the hands of the user or for engagement by a trowel or tool for lifting or moving the kneeling device as a whole. For most convenient use in cement finishing or similar tasks, two of the devices may be employed, the first one for the worker to kneel upon and the second one for his feet to rest upon during one stage of the work. When that stage has been completed, the worker can move backward to kneel on the second device and then move the first one rearwardly to support his feet and prevent contact with the cement being finished.

1n the embodiment of the invention shown in FIGS. 1 and 2, the kneeling device comprises a flat relatively thin base having a smooth bottom surface, impervious to moisture, and readily movable and slidable over a surface (not shown) such as a cement floor or walk which is being ice finished by the user of the device. Thebase 10 is generally rectangular in shape, having parallel longitudinal edges 11 and upwardlycurved ends 12 which terminate in inwardlycurved edge portions 13. Theparts 12, 13 provide handle means Which extends the full width of each end of the kneeling device, readily accessible to the user who may grasp the handles by hand or by inserting a trowel or other tool into thespace 16 to engage the inner surfaces of theparts 12, 13, to move the kneeling pad from one place to another.
Apad 15 is mounted on the upper surface of thebase 10 and extends from one longitudinal edge 11 to the opposite edge 11, but is shorter than the longitudinal dimension of thebase 10, to providespaces 16 between each end of thepad 15 and the curvedupturned end portions 12, 13, of the base. Thespaces 16 provide for access to the handles formed by the end portions.
Thepad 15 comprises acover 17 of moisture impervious material andfiller 18 which is resilient, quickly expansible after compression, non-porous and non-absorbent. A commercially available product which has the required characteristics is known as Ensolite (a registered trademark of United States Rubber Company). Thecover 17 may be of vinyl or other suitable material. Thepad 15 may be attached to the top of the base by anysuitable cement 19.
The modified form of the kneeling pad shown in FIGS. 3-5 is similar to the construction shown in FIGS. 1 and 2 excepting that thebase 20 is provided with longitudinally extending upwardly directedside edge flanges 21. The handle members provided by the upwardlycurved portions 12 and inwardlycurved portions 13 are the same as theparts 12 and 13 heretofore described. The construction of thepad 15 is the same as described, its longitudinal side surfaces being confined between and protected by theedge flanges 21 of thebase 20.
